Tussock swamp twig rush features slender, reed-like stems and tufts of bright green foliage. This grass-like perennial prefers moist environments, often flourishing near wetlands. Its sturdy, upright growth habit is adapted to the challenges of soggy soil, yet tussock swamp twig rush also shows resilience in drier conditions. The narrow leaves and wiry texture make it a distinctive presence in its native habitat.

Pruning:
Tussock swamp twig rush thrives in wet habitats and benefits from early spring pruning. Removing old foliage enhances growth and air circulation. Trim weak stems at the base to encourage robust new growth, aligning with the plant's growth cycle for optimal recovery and vigor.
